摘要
Functional rehabilitation of neurourological patients always starts with patient education, retraining, and occupational therapy, possibly completed by medical treatments. In the light of a systematic review of the literature, the authors describe the various treatments that can be used orally and by intravesical instillation in these patients. They also describe treatments such as desmopressin or agents that increase sphincter pressure, which can sometimes be very useful to obtain stable clinical results that are satisfactory for the patient.
